Job Description
Assists the Program Director and accounting office staff to accumulate and classify program financial documents. Assists in preparation of program financial reports. Provides administrative assistance to Program Director and professional staff.
Duties:
Receives sorts, classifies program financial documents and presents these in orderly fashion to the IFDC accounting office.
Provides administrative support services to the Program Director and, as he so directs, to other professional program staff.
Required Skills or Experience
Must have an appropriate level of knowledge, skills, and abilities in both financial and administrative management and a minimum of 3 years of experience.
Must have a record of successful experience as an administrative or financial assistant.
Fluency in French and/or English and working knowledge in the second language is required.
This position requires fluency/proficiency in both English and French. Previous USAID experience will be an added advantage. Candidates who cannot read, write and speak in both languages will be disqualified.
